Nine News Melbourne anchor Peter Hitchener taken off air mid-bulletin after migraine


Veteran news anchor Peter Hitchener has been taken off air mid-bulletin after stumbling over his words during Channel Nine's 6pm Melbourne news. Veteran news anchor Peter Hitchener has been taken off air mid-bulletin after suffering a migraineHitchener was replaced on the broadcast by Clint Stanway who acknowledged the anchor's absence before moving on with the news. Nine tweeted that the news legend was feeling OK before the end of the broadcast, with Hitchener himself tweeting just after its conclusion at 7pm that he was fine. Other observers said Hitchener looked to have been struggling throughout the broadcast and were relieved to see him taken off and hear that he was fine.
